This page covers emergency access for the support team during the Tilbury consent banner rollout. If the banner misfires and blocks sign-in for a region, you may need to flip the regional kill switch directly, bypassing the normal change process. The kill-switch console sits behind a sealed credentials vault that only opens during declared incidents. Log the incident number first, notify the on-call engineer, and document your reason in the rollout channel. Then unseal the vault with the recovery passphrase below.

vault phrase of tajeg-tageg = pelix-druix-holius-briael-zorwyn-frawyn-fraox-norok-drueth-aldiel

This PR adds backpressure to the Skylark notification fan-out so a single hot topic can't starve the whole dispatcher. For the security review: the shed path drops lowest-priority messages first, never auth or account-recovery notices, and all drops are logged to the Brackenhall audit stream. No new ingress surface, just internal queue plumbing. The thresholds are intentionally conservative for launch and gathered in one place, shown below.

tuning table, yajog-yahof:
BUDGETS = {
    "lamvan": 303,
    "wenox": 460,
    "fenvan": 525,
}

Ticket #-- : Vault locked — Duskboard admin dashboard

The settings vault for Duskboard locked itself after three failed attempts while QA was testing the new dark-mode toggle. Dark-mode preferences are stored inside the vault, so theme changes currently fail silently for all admins. Support can unlock it from the recovery screen without filing an escalation. Use the recovery passphrase listed below.

vault phrase of hahop-badug = novvan-ulaion-zorius-noviel-gorwyn-casix-tamys

Handover note — Kiosk watchdog (Orvik platform)

Welcome aboard. The watchdog daemon on the Brightstand kiosks restarts the app if the heartbeat stops for 90 seconds; logs live under the usual service directory. Tuning parameters sit in a sealed config store — don't edit live units directly. To unlock that store after a factory reset, you'll need the recovery passphrase noted below.

unlock words, yawig-kagef: gordor-holvan-ulaael-pramir-ulaiel-tamdor